Job Description:

As part of the annual action plan, you will be responsible for the constant improvement of the quality of IKEA products as well as the production process and workflow through tools such as 5S, Lean, and machine capacity utilization. All with the aim of reducing production inefficiencies, in terms of sustainability and business ethics.

Job Responsibility:

  • Developing relationships with suppliers
  • Data analytics
  • Operation - helping suppliers with entering up-to-date product documents into the system to secure compliance, resolving claims from A to Z, regular communication with suppliers (emails, calls), meetings with management and the team

Requirements:

  • Relevant experience of 4-8 years in hard goods - mix materials / ceramics / paper
  • Proven experience in Quality & Compliance / Production environment, good knowledge of materials properties, production processes and technologies
  • The ability to think out-of-the-box and critically in the constant search for ways to improve our products
  • Analytical thinking, which you will use in analysing processes from the beginning of product implementation to data evaluation and finding improvements, cost savings, better design or quality
  • Patience and good communication to help you find common ground with suppliers of different nationalities and to meet IKEA’s business demands
  • The ability to manage time well, to balance between the factory floor and office work
